There’s a new student in Class 2B: Holly Hurricane, a girl with long, unruly dark hair that gets curlier as the weather changes. She wears a black tutu and a T-shirt with a lightning bolt printed on it, and seems to have the power to control weather phenomena! Rumor has it among her classmates that she’s a witch… but she, with the help of Ronnie Rondella, decides to prove everyone wrong by building a wonderful (and somewhat scientific) weather station. She still doesn’t know that a real storm is about to hit Picco Pernacchia, threatening to destroy Rodari School forever! Holly is the only one who can save everyone… but will she succeed?

Igor De Amicis

Igor De Amicis was born in Rome in 1976. Chief Commissioner of the Penitentiary Police, he shares his passion for writing with his wife Paola Luciani. Together they have written Giù nella miniera (Down the Mine), selected for the Bancarellino Prize 2017 reading project and winner of the Special Children’s Prize at the Parco Majella Prize 2017. Also for Einaudi Ragazzi, they have written Fugees Football Club, Igor Trocchia. A calcio al razzismo (Igor Trocchia. A Kick to Racism), Roberto Mancini nella terra dei fuochi (Roberto Mancini in the Ground of the Fires), L’ultima verità (The Ultimate Truth) and various titles of the Classicini, Grandissimi and Che storia! series. For Il Battello a Vapore, they have published Il mistero delle lettere senza nome (The Mystery of the Nameless Letters). Igor has also published several noir novels for adults, including La settima lapide Dea Planeta, O’ Regno Salani and Gioventù criminale (Criminal Youth), Piemme. The pair’s books have been translated in several countries (Greece, Spain, Poland, South America, Japan, Germany, etc.)

Paola Luciani

Paola Luciani was born in Pescara in 1980. A support teacher in primary schools, she invents, imagines and writes her stories together with her husband Igor De Amicis. Paola has also published several essays and monographs on the world of education.
